.elementor-446 .elementor-element.elementor-element-903554c{--display:flex;--background-transition:0.3s;--padding-block-start:0px;--padding-block-end:0px;--padding-inline-start:0px;--padding-inline-end:0px;}.elementor-446 .elementor-element.elementor-element-615dae1 .elementor-button .elementor-align-icon-right{margin-left:0px;}.elementor-446 .elementor-element.elementor-element-615dae1 .elementor-button .elementor-align-icon-left{margin-right:0px;}.elementor-446 .elementor-element.elementor-element-615dae1 .elementor-button{font-family:"Montserrat-local", Sans-serif;font-size:1.1rem;line-height:1.2em;border-style:none;border-radius:10px 10px 10px 10px;padding:20px 30px 20px 30px;}.elementor-446 .elementor-element.elementor-element-615dae1 .elementor-button:hover, .elementor-446 .elementor-element.elementor-element-615dae1 .elementor-button:focus{color:#FFFFFF;background-color:#5371BD;}.elementor-446 .elementor-element.elementor-element-615dae1 .elementor-button:hover svg, .elementor-446 .elementor-element.elementor-element-615dae1 .elementor-button:focus svg{fill:#FFFFFF;}.elementor-446 .elementor-element.elementor-element-615dae1 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}@media(max-width:767px){.elementor-446 .elementor-element.elementor-element-615dae1 .elementor-button{padding:015px 20px 015px 20px;}}/* Start custom CSS for button, class: .elementor-element-615dae1 */@media (min-width: 768px) {
        .elementor-446 .elementor-element.elementor-element-615dae1 .elementor-button {
        height: 100px;
        display: flex;
        justify-content: center;
        align-items: center;
    }
}

@media (max-width: 767px) {
    .elementor-446 .elementor-element.elementor-element-615dae1 .elementor-button {
        background-color: #FFFFFF;
        color: #3D59AD;
    }
}/* End custom CSS */